Why is risk management important in cricket event planning?

Risk management is the process of identifying, assessing, and prioritizing risks to minimize their impact on an organization or event. In the context of cricket event planning, effective risk management can help organizers anticipate and mitigate potential issues before they escalate into major problems. By proactively addressing risks, event planners can ensure the safety of players, spectators, and staff, as well as protect the reputation and financial viability of the event itself.

Common risks in cricket event planning

There are several types of risks that event organizers should be aware of when planning a cricket event. These can include:

– Weather-related risks: Outdoor cricket events are susceptible to weather disruptions such as rain, strong winds, or extreme heat. Organizers should have contingency plans in place to reschedule matches, relocate to indoor facilities, or provide shelter for spectators.

– Health and safety risks: From player injuries to medical emergencies among spectators, there are various health and safety risks that can arise during a cricket event. It is essential to have trained medical staff on-site, as well as clear emergency response protocols.

– Security risks: Large-scale cricket events can attract large crowds, making them potential targets for security threats such as vandalism, theft, or even terrorism. Event organizers should work closely with law enforcement and security professionals to assess and address security risks.

– Financial risks: Budget overruns, ticketing fraud, sponsorship disputes, and other financial risks can impact the financial viability of a cricket event. Organizers should have robust financial controls in place to monitor expenses and revenues accurately.

– Legal risks: Compliance with local regulations, contracts with vendors and sponsors, liability insurance, and other legal considerations are essential components of risk management in cricket event planning. Failure to address legal risks can result in costly lawsuits and reputational damage.

Risk management strategies for cricket event planning

To effectively manage risks in cricket event planning, organizers can implement the following strategies:

– Conduct a thorough risk assessment: Identify potential risks by analyzing past events, conducting site visits, and consulting with stakeholders. Prioritize risks based on their likelihood and potential impact on the event.

– Develop a risk management plan: Create a detailed plan that outlines how each identified risk will be managed, including specific actions, responsibilities, timelines, and resources. Communicate the plan to all relevant parties to ensure alignment.

– Implement risk mitigation measures: Take proactive steps to reduce the likelihood and impact of identified risks. This can include securing insurance coverage, conducting safety inspections, training staff on emergency procedures, and establishing communication protocols.

– Monitor and evaluate risks: Regularly monitor the status of identified risks throughout the event planning process. Update the risk management plan as needed based on new information or changing circumstances.

– Respond to incidents effectively: In the event of a risk materializing, respond promptly and decisively to minimize its impact. Follow established protocols and communicate transparently with stakeholders to address concerns and maintain trust.

– Review and learn from past events: After the cricket event is concluded, conduct a comprehensive debriefing to evaluate the effectiveness of the risk management strategies implemented. Identify areas for improvement and incorporate lessons learned into future event planning efforts.

FAQs

Q: How can I assess weather-related risks for an outdoor cricket event?
A: Consult historical weather data for the event location, work with meteorologists to forecast conditions, and have contingency plans in place for inclement weather.

Q: What security measures should be taken for a large cricket event?
A: Implement crowd control measures, security screenings for attendees, surveillance systems, and collaboration with law enforcement agencies.

Q: How can I protect against financial risks in cricket event planning?
A: Maintain accurate financial records, leverage technology for ticketing and revenue tracking, conduct regular audits, and secure appropriate insurance coverage.
